Lots of people are suggesting Apple’s own Reminders app, so perhaps it’s worth explaining why it doesn’t work for me.
I use Reminders all the time as a grocery list, and I find the UI reasonable for that. However, for tasks, I find it confusing and noisy (I prefer Todoist), and I don’t think it’s actually very good at reminding me to do things. It tries once, and gives up until the next day! A strange behaviour, for an app named “Reminders”.
